About Reginald M. Benton Middle

Reginald M. Benton Middle, located in La Mirada, California, is a regular public middle school serving students from sixth to eighth grade. With an enrollment of 714 students and a student-to-teacher ratio of 25.5:1, the school provides a supportive educational environment with 28 full-time equivalent teachers.

Reginald M. Benton Middle ranks at #4529 out of 9566 schools in California, placing it in the 53rd percentile overall. Its MySchoolScout rating is 5.6/10 and its academic score stands at 6.1/10, indicating areas for improvement but also showing dedication to student development.

In terms of academic performance, 51% of students are proficient or above in ELA/Reading, while 27% achieve proficiency or higher in Math. What Parents Should Know

The student-teacher ratio at Reginald M. Benton Middle is 25.5:1, which is higher than the national average. This may mean larger class sizes, so parents should ask about classroom support, teaching assistants, and how the school differentiates instruction for students who need extra help.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Reginald M. Benton Middle has a median household income of $110,606. It is a well-educated community where 40%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$765,100, with a median rent of $2,052/month. The local poverty rate of 6.5% is relatively low. The average commute for residents is 32 minutes.
